#54954d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#54954d is composed of 32.9% red, 58.4% green and 30.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 43.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 48.3%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 114.2 degrees, a saturation of 31.9% and a lightness of 44.3%. #54954d color hex could be obtained by blending #a8ff9a with #002b00.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

Shades and Tints of #54954d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040703 is the darkest color, while #f9fcf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#54954d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#707270 is the less saturated color, while #1cdb07 is the most saturated one.
